Abstract

AI has been introduced into design courses to enhance student learning outcomes, foster creativity, provide personalised learning support and improve design productivity. This study integrated AI tools as a facilitative aid in a creative product design course, focusing on examining students' learning outcomes and the creativity of their final products by comparing two groups: the T1 experimental group (AI use) and the T2 control group (no AI use). Students' perspectives of using AI were explored. A total number of 77 undergraduate students majoring in product design at a university in China were recruited for the study. The results indicate that the integration of AI tools into the course significantly enhanced students' learning outcomes and the creativity of their final products. Furthermore, students expressed a positive attitude toward using AI in learning and designing, and a willingness to utilise AI in future design work. Challenges and concerns were also highlighted related to AI use for learning and design.
